Boeing Companys asset-for-equity gamble on Archer (ACHR.US) is a transition from a cash-burning competition to a commercial realization of the low-altitude economy.
Boeing will sell several of its divisions to Archer Aviation in order to focus on its core commercial and defense sectors. Archer will take over Boeing's Wisk, SkyGrid, and Insitu divisions, which are responsible for the design and construction of unmanned aircraft and air traffic management systems.
American Airlines Group Inc. and aerospace manufacturing giant Boeing Company (BA.US) will sell several of its business units dedicated to developing low-altitude flying taxis and drone technology to American "low-altitude economy" leader Archer Aviation Inc (ACHR.US). This shift indicates that the American aircraft manufacturer is refocusing on its core commercial aircraft and military defense business. Following the announcement, Archer Aviation's stock surged by over 15% in early trading.
A more significant signal regarding eVTOL (electric Vertical Take-Off and Landing aircraft) and the entire "low-altitude economy" is that industry competition is evolving from "who can build a flying electric urban aircraft" to "who can build a complete low-altitude aviation ecosystem."
The two companies stated in a joint announcement on Monday that California-based Archer will take over Boeing Company's Wisk, SkyGrid, and Insitu business units, which are involved in the design and manufacturing of unmanned aerial vehicles and urban air traffic management systems. Archer now gains Wisk's autonomy, SkyGrid's airspace intelligence (a system using AI and machine learning to optimize flight routes and air traffic flow), and a wealth of real flight data from Insitu. Coupled with its own Midnight, drone, and aviation AI platform, Archer is evolving from an eVTOL OEM to a "Drone/Autonomy + Airspace OS + Military/Defense" Physical AI aerial taxi super platform.
Boeing Company is integrating Wisk, SkyGrid, and Insitu into Archer, in exchange for nearly a 20% equity stake while retaining rights to core autonomous flight technology. The real signal being sent is not that "Boeing Company is exiting eVTOL," but that the low-altitude economy is moving from a decentralized, money-burning prototype race to a stage of platform integration focused on autonomous flight, airspace management, integrated manufacturing, and defense scenarios.
Boeing Company is "slimming down," while Archer is accelerating its expansion!
According to the statement, as part of the deal, Boeing Company will also acquire a portion of Archer's stock and reach a significant technology-sharing agreement with them. Through this latest agreement, Boeing Company will continue to hold rights to Wisk's core autonomous flight technology to apply it to the current and next generation of commercial and military aircraft manufacturing systems.
After years of managerial missteps and quality delivery issueswhich led to the replacement of the previous management teamBoeing Company has been dedicated to reversing its overall business situation. The sale of non-core assets beyond its core commercial and military aerospace business is a significant corrective measure. Its largest competitor, Airbus SE, based in Europe, also paused its development plan for the so-called "urban flying taxi" last year.
After the COVID-19 pandemic in 2020, many pure electric vertical takeoff and landing (eVTOL) companies went public and burned through billions in research and development. Archer is currently one of the few stable eVTOL developers still in operation, recognized as one of the top developers in the field.
The Trump administration, in a 2025 executive order regarding "U.S. drone dominance," prioritized eVTOL testing. Earlier this year, the Federal Aviation Administration (FAA) initiated an eVTOL Integration Pilot Program, selecting eight projects across 26 states to test urban air taxis, cargo, medical transport, and autonomous flight.
The Midnight aircraft developed by Archer is not expected to receive formal air taxi regulatory certification from the FAA until next year at the earliest.
Following the announcement, Archer's stock price surged by 25% in pre-market trading. Boeing Companys stock remained relatively flat; after the market opened, Archers stock rose over 15%.
In 2023, Boeing Company became the sole owner of Wisk. Wisk is a startup focused on urban air taxis, backed by the Alphabet Inc. Class C research team. At that time, the century-old aerospace giant aimed to leverage Silicon Valley's technological prowess to expand its presence in the future-oriented autonomous aircraft field.
Archers acquisition of Wisk, SkyGrid, and Insitu marks a significant consolidation in the low-altitude economy.
On the surface, this deal appears to be Boeing Company selling non-core assets; in reality, it resembles a form of "capital exit + technology retention + reinvestment" in industry restructuring. Archer will acquire Wisk Aero, SkyGrid, and Insitu from Boeing Company. Wisk will contribute its autonomous flight technology accrued through six generations of aircraft and over 1,700 test flights, SkyGrid will provide traffic management software for automated airspace, and Insitu boasts mature drone and defense operations, covering 35 countries and currently generating over $200 million in annual revenue; together, these three companies have nearly 2 million hours of flight experience.
At the same time, Boeing Company has not fully exited, having acquired nearly 20% equity in Archer after the merger, retaining usage rights to Wisk's core autonomous flight technology, and continuing technological collaboration with Archer. For Boeing Company, this move transfers the high costs and long certification cycles of eVTOL development risks to a specialized platform while retaining future technological and equity growth potential. For Archer, it fills in key pieces of the puzzle encompassing crewed eVTOL, autonomous flight, drones, airspace management, and defense revenue.
For the eVTOL sector and even the entire "low-altitude economy" supply chain, a more critical signal is that industry competition is upgrading from "who can build a flying electric aircraft" to "who can create a complete low-altitude aviation system." The true bottlenecks to large-scale commercialization are not just batteries, motors, and aerodynamic design, but also safety redundancies, flight control and perception, FAA airworthiness certification, autonomous operation, real-time airspace dispatch, ground infrastructure, and traffic management during concurrent operations of thousands of aircraft.
U.S. regulatory bodies have entered the real operational verification stage: the FAAs eVTOL Integration Pilot Program has selected eight projects covering 26 states, testing urban air taxis, cargo, medical transport, and autonomous flight, with Archer participating in projects across New York, New Jersey, Texas, and Florida. This indicates that the U.S. low-altitude economy is transitioning from the "prototype demonstration" phase to a stage of certificationoperationairspace infrastructurelarge-scale deployment.
This deal also signifies that eVTOL is entering the second phase of "winner-takes-all," rather than the entire industry being seen skeptically by Boeing Company. After the pandemic, many eVTOL startups relied on capital market financing to burn money on R&D, but aviation manufacturing involves extremely high certification costs, accident liabilities, capital expenditures for manufacturing, and operational thresholds, making it unlikely for dozens of independent airframe manufacturers to coexist. By consolidating Wisk, SkyGrid, and Insitu into Archer while becoming a strategic shareholder with nearly 20% ownership, Boeing Company is actively promoting the concentration of resources towards leading platforms. The companies that are truly likely to achieve long-term valuation premiums in the future low-altitude economy are not merely those that can produce flying aircraft, but rather platform enterprises capable of overcoming barriers in airworthiness certification, large-scale manufacturing, Physical AI autonomy, airspace digitization, and dual-use business models.
